Flying from Phoenix Sky Harbour International Airport (PHX) to Louis Armstrong New Orleans International Airport (MSY): what you need to know
Around 2 hours 55 minutes is how long you can expect to be in the air on a direct flight from Phoenix Sky Harbour International Airport to Louis Armstrong New Orleans International Airport.
New Orleans is two hours ahead of Phoenix and observes the UTC-5 timezone.

Getting from Louis Armstrong New Orleans International Airport (MSY) to central New Orleans
MSY is located at 900 Airline Highway.
Louis Armstrong New Orleans International Airport is roughly 24 kilometres from the centre of New Orleans. Driving there takes about 20 minutes.
Getting to the centre on public transport takes around 50 minutes.
When to fly to Louis Armstrong New Orleans International Airport (MSY)
The quietest month for a flight from Phoenix Sky Harbour International Airport to Louis Armstrong New Orleans International Airport is May, while October is the busiest. Choose the ideal time to visit New Orleans based on whether you prefer a more fast-paced or easygoing experience.
The warmest month in New Orleans is August, with temperatures ranging between 25ºC (77ºF) and 36ºC (97ºF). Book your flights from Phoenix Sky Harbour International Airport to Louis Armstrong New Orleans International Airport in this month if you enjoy this type of weather.
Look for cheap tickets from PHX to MSY in January if you like travelling in cooler conditions. Temperatures are at their lowest then, ranging between 4ºC (39ºF) and 18ºC (64ºF) on average.

Baton Rouge is just one of the many cities in United States waiting to be discovered once you've seen New Orleans. Around 121 kilometres away to the north-west, well-known attractions include Louisiana State Capitol, Louisiana's Old State Capitol and Shaw Centre for the Arts.
Montgomery is another essential stop in United States and is around 451 kilometres north-east of New Orleans. No trip is complete without seeing Civil Rights Memorial, Rosa Parks Museum and Dexter Avenue King Memorial Baptist Church.
